2. What is an eSIM?
An eSIM, or embedded SIM, is essentially a digital version of a SIM card, enabling cellular plan activation without requiring a tangible card. Unlike traditional SIM cards, which are physical chips that must be inserted into a device, an eSIM is built directly into the device's hardware during manufacturing. This integrated design provides a much more efficient and adaptable method for mobile connectivity.
The fundamental distinction between a traditional SIM card and an eSIM lies in their form factor and programmability. A physical SIM card is a small, removable plastic chip that holds your subscriber information, phone number, and other relevant network data. Switching between mobile providers or service plans typically involves physically replacing your current SIM card. In contrast, an eSIM is a small chip permanently embedded within the device, and its profile can be remotely provisioned and reprogrammed by network operators.
The functioning of eSIM technology is remarkably intricate. It leverages a secure element within the device that securely stores multiple network profiles. If a user intends to activate a new plan or change mobile operators, their device interacts with the carrier's provisioning server. This server then securely transmits the new profile to the eSIM, complete with all required authentication data and network parameters. This procedure removes the requirement for physical interaction, thus streamlining activation and switching processes.
A broad spectrum of devices is progressively adopting eSIM capabilities. While initially prevalent in premium smartphones such as Apple iPhones (from XS and later models), Google Pixel devices, and select Samsung Galaxy series, its integration has broadened considerably. Presently, you can find it in smartwatches (e.g., Apple Watch, Samsung Galaxy Watch), tablets (e.g., iPad Cellular models), cellular-enabled laptops, and an increasing number of IoT applications.
Globally, eSIM adoption is on an upward trajectory, driven by consumer demand for flexibility and manufacturer push for sleeker, port-less designs. Within the US, prominent carriers have readily adopted this technology, positioning it as a fundamental component for activating new devices and offering services. Such extensive adoption emphasizes eSIM's significance as a key building block for the future of mobile communication.
eSIM's Position in the American Market
3.1 Regulatory and Market Environment
A significant market for eSIM technology, the United States is defined by the active interaction between regulatory encouragement and fierce market competition. Although strict government regulations for eSIM adoption are not in place, the Federal Communications Commission (FCC) broadly supports innovation and consumer options, which perfectly complements the advantages of eSIM. Instead, the primary driver for eSIM expansion in the US has predominantly originated from leading mobile network operators (MNOs) and device producers acknowledging its strategic benefits.
All principal US carriers—AT&T, Verizon, and T-Mobile—have completely adopted eSIM technology, providing extensive support for numerous compatible devices. These carriers offer streamlined activation processes, typically through their proprietary apps or QR code methods, and have woven eSIM into their essential service portfolios. This widespread carrier adoption is crucial, as it ensures that consumers can leverage eSIM capabilities across the most popular networks. Moreover, Mobile Virtual Network Operators (MVNOs) are increasingly providing eSIM services, which in turn widens consumer selections.
Current market trends suggest a considerable rise in eSIM integration across the United States. Industry analyst reports forecast a substantial surge in eSIM-capable devices and subscriptions in the coming years, propelled by the growth of 5G networks, IoT expansion, and sustained consumer desire for greater adaptability. The US market, with its high smartphone penetration and early adoption of new technologies, is particularly ripe for this growth.

4. How eSIM Works in the USA
4.1 Activation Process
The activation of an eSIM in the USA is a simple procedure, primarily crafted for user ease and remote configuration. Unlike traditional SIM cards, which require physical insertion, eSIM activation typically involves digital provisioning.
Your carrier's QR code is typically the primary method for eSIM activation. When you buy an eSIM plan, online or in person, your carrier will give you a unique QR code. Users simply navigate to their device's settings (e.g., "Cellular" or "Mobile Data" settings on an iPhone), select "Add Cellular Plan," and scan the QR code. Within minutes, the device automatically downloads and configures the eSIM profile, connecting to the network.
Some carriers also offer activation through their dedicated mobile applications. With this method, you log into your carrier's app and follow the steps to activate your eSIM, often using your existing account details. The remote provisioning and management feature is central to eSIM, facilitating smooth changes without requiring a store visit or waiting for a physical SIM.
eSIM activation is much faster and more convenient than traditional SIM activation, which involves physical insertion and potential device restarts. It reduces errors from incorrect card placement and removes the risk of losing or damaging the small physical SIM.
Supported Devices and Compatibility
The adoption of eSIM in the USA is heavily influenced by device compatibility. Thankfully, the majority of flagship smartphones from major manufacturers released recently offer eSIM support.
Key US devices compatible with eSIM are:
Apple iPhones: iPhone XS, XS Max, XR, and all succeeding models (iPhone 11, 12, 13, 14, 15 series, encompassing Pro, Pro Max, and Mini versions).
Pixel Devices by Google: Pixel 3, 3a, and all subsequent models (Pixel 4, 5, 6, 7, 8 series, including 'a' and 'Pro' variants).

Galaxy Devices from Samsung: Specific models from the Galaxy S series (e.g., S20, S21, S22, S23, S24 series), Galaxy Note series (e.g., Note 20), and Galaxy Fold/Flip series.
Other Devices: Various smartwatches (Apple Watch Series 3 and later, Samsung Galaxy Watch series), iPads with cellular connectivity, and select Windows laptops with integrated cellular modems.
Compatibility considerations for US consumers primarily revolve around ensuring their specific device model and operating system version support eSIM, as well as confirming that their chosen carrier offers eSIM services for that device. While most newer devices are compatible, it's always advisable to check with the device manufacturer or carrier before making a purchase or switching to an eSIM plan.
4.3 Use Cases Specific to the US Market
eSIM technology's adaptability opens up many practical uses specifically designed for the distinct requirements of the US market.
Travel and Roaming Solutions: For US travelers, eSIM vastly simplifies international roaming. Rather than purchasing local SIM cards in every country or paying high roaming charges, users can download local data plans to their device either before or upon reaching their destination. This offers cost-effective, convenient, and instant connectivity, making business trips and vacations more seamless.
Business and Organizational Implementations: American businesses, ranging from small startups to major corporations, gain significantly from eSIM's centralized management features. IT departments are able to remotely provision and oversee cellular connectivity for their entire inventory of company-provided devices, thereby simplifying deployment, cutting down on logistical expenses, and bolstering security. This is particularly vital for field service teams, sales personnel, and mobile workforces who demand consistent, dependable connectivity.
IoT and Smart Device Implementations in America: With the US at the forefront of IoT innovation, eSIM serves as a fundamental technology for its sustained development. eSIM provides flexible, scalable, and secure connectivity for a wide array of IoT devices, including smart city infrastructure, connected vehicles, industrial sensors, and consumer wearables. The remote network switching capability is crucial for devices deployed in different locations or those needing failover connectivity.

6. Future Outlook of eSIM in the USA
eSIM technology in the US is on a trajectory of continuous growth and innovation. As e sim card usa and digital transformation speeds up, eSIM is positioned to become even more crucial in linking devices and services.
New trends suggest even more integrated and secure SIM technologies, like iSIM (integrated SIM), where the SIM's capabilities are embedded directly into the device's primary processor. This further miniaturization and integration will unlock new possibilities for ultra-compact devices and enhanced security. The American market, known for its strong interest in advanced technology, is expected to lead the way in adopting these next-gen SIM solutions.
The integration of eSIM with 5G networks is particularly significant. 5G promises ultra-low latency, massive connectivity, and unprecedented speeds, and eSIM provides the flexible provisioning mechanism to fully leverage these capabilities across diverse devices. eSIM will facilitate the rapid deployment and management of 5G-enabled devices, from enhanced mobile broadband to mission-critical communications.
Furthermore, eSIM's role in the Internet of Things (IoT) ecosystem is set to expand exponentially. As more devices become connected—from smart home appliances to industrial machinery—the need for efficient, scalable, and secure cellular connectivity will grow. eSIM provides the ideal solution for managing these vast and diverse networks of IoT devices, enabling remote updates, simplified logistics, and global reach.
